ITS
PosConfidenceEllipseData.h
Go to the documentation of this file.
1 
5 #ifndef POSCONFIDENCEELLIPSEDATA_H
6 #define POSCONFIDENCEELLIPSEDATA_H
7 
8 #include <QByteArray>
9 
10 #include <apiData.h>
11 
12 #include <PosConfidenceEllipse.h>
13 
15 {
16 public:
26  PosConfidenceEllipseData(char *data, int *offset);
32 
33  /* Getters */
38  quint16 semiMajorConfidence() const{return m_semiMajorConfidence;}
43  quint16 semiMinorConfidence() const{return m_semiMinorConfidence;}
49 
50  /* Setters */
66 
71  QByteArray toBin();
81  QString toString();
82 
83 private:
87 };
88 
89 #endif // POSCONFIDENCEELLIPSEDATA_H
QByteArray toBin()
toBin Byte array PosConfidenceEllipseData encoder.
PosConfidenceEllipse_t toASN()
toASN C style PosConfidenceEllipseData encoder.
quint16 semiMajorOrientation() const
semiMajorOrientation Orientation to the North.
void setSemiMajorConfidence(quint16 s)
setSemiMajorConfidence Semi major confidence setter.
void setSemiMinorConfidence(quint16 s)
setSemiMainrConfidence Semi minor confidence setter.
quint16 semiMajorConfidence() const
semiMajorConfidence Semi major confidence getter.
void setSemiMajorOrientation(quint16 s)
setSemiMajorOrientation Orientation to the North setter.
QString toString()
toString Human readable PosConfidenceEllipseData encoder.
quint16 semiMinorConfidence() const
semiMinorConfidence Semi minor confidence getter.
PosConfidenceEllipseData()
PosConfidenceEllipseData PosConfidenceEllipseData constructor.
API used for C++ style data.